The Bachelors 2023 Which Couples Are Still Together?
On December 20th, the Bachelors 2023 finale aired on free-to-air TV. Ben Wadell chose Mckenna, and Luke Bateman chose Ellie. In the final speech, Wes met Brea, but he ultimately left the show without choosing anyone. The episode was available to stream on 10Play a day before airing on TV.
Brea and Wes
Brea and Wes were exclusive until the last episode, but things changed. Brea explained to Wes that they hadn't found a middle ground, leading to the end of their relationship.
After filming The Bachelors, Brea entered a new relationship. The 28-year-old shared with Refinery29 that she and her mystery man are exclusive and now share the same living space.
She emphasized, "I wanted to make sure that I continue down that path. I have been voicing my opinion and setting my boundaries, expressing what I want. And now, there’s a guy who wants to meet me halfway."
Ben and McKenna
Ben and McKenna, who recently appeared on TV, have called it quits. Ben shared on Instagram that their relationship didn't work out as they had hoped. The challenge of being in different time zones due to overseas commitments made the distance difficult.
Despite the breakup, Ben mentioned that he and McKenna remain "great friends." He expressed excitement about her future and what it holds for her.
